‘Law & Order: SVU’ season 15 spoilers: A tiny tease on Mariska Hargitay’s next big episode

Law & Order: SVU logoWhen “Law & Order: SVU” returns to NBC on Wednesday, January 8, it is going to be doing so with an episode that you may or may not have heard about already: “Psycho Therapist.” Basically, the show has decided for dramatic reasons that rather than just letting you into the second half of the season in an easy manner, they are instead going to make you go through something more emotional than any case that we’ve seen since the premiere: Watching Olivia Benson have to confront what is basically one of the hardest situations in her life yet again.

Lewis (Pablo Schreiber) is going to be back on the show since the early episodes of the season, but in a very different sort of capacity than we have seen so far. Basically, we’re going to have a chance to see her face off with this guy in the courtroom, and try to channel all of the emotions and see what the courtroom side of this story is going to be.

While it may not reveal too much, you can see the official synopsis below from NBC for at least a basic take on what this story will be:

“The trial of serial rapist William Lewis once again pits Benson against her attacker.”

Given that this is not a show that tends to do a heck of a lot of long-term story arcs, we imagine that whatever happens here will serve as some sort of closure for at least a little while. If anything, maybe it will be addressed at the end of the season; but personally, we’d like to see the show go in a different, less dramatic direction then.
